Alliance Grows To 15 Members, Adds Taipei To Asian Hub
Network
Global airline alliance Skyteam added China Airlines as its 15th
member at a joining ceremony held in Taipei Tuesday. The flag
passenger and cargo carrier of Taiwan, China Airlines becomes the
first Taiwanese airline to join SkyTeam.
From its hub in Taipei, China Airlines operates a diverse
passenger and cargo network throughout the wider Asia pacific
region, North America and Europe, with a total of 224 daily
departures to 80 destinations. The new member also brings three new
destinations to the SkyTeam network: Okinawa and Miyazaki, Japan;
and Surabaya, Indonesia.
Sdyteam says China Airlines complements the network of existing
members, China Southern and China Eastern, and offers an extensive
cross-strait operation to 20 major destinations in China. This
provides SkyTeam customers with an unrivalled choice of travel
options in the Greater China region.
"Thanks to excellent links to a number of existing SkyTeam
hubs, China Airlines' membership adds value to the alliance for
both passengers and cargo customers," said Michael Wisbrun,
SkyTeam's Managing Director. "Adding a quality brand from a strong
economic region will support SkyTeam's focus on our top priority-
enhancing our products and services for our customers
worldwide."
Delta president Ed Bastian attended the official joining
ceremony in Taipei alongside representatives from fellow SkyTeam
member airlines. "The addition of this well respected airline
complements Delta's existing service to Taiwan and with China
Airline's strong hub in Taipei our customers will benefit from
improved access to one of the world's fastest-growing regions," he
said.
